View Single Post
Old 19th April 2019, 23:35   #55851  |  Link
Alexkral
Registered User
 
Join Date: Oct 2018
Posts: 323
Still I think there's a reasonable doubt about possible clipping when the source profile of the 3DLUT is BT.2020. This is from madshi 11-24-2017:

Quote:
Gamut:

madVR doesn't convert the gamut, unless the 3DLUT (SDR or HDR, doesn't matter) expects a different gamut than the source provides. E.g. if your 3DLUT is BT.2020 and the video is also BT.2020 then madVR doesn't do any gamut processing. However, if your 3DLUT was made for BT.709 videos, but the video is BT.2020, then madVR will convert gamut from BT.2020 to BT.709. Basically madVR makes sure that the 3DLUT receives the pixels in the format it expects.
Pixel shader math is done in ICtCp and when the result is converted to RGB, some colors may fall out of gamut. When madVR converts the gamut, it maps those colors back in gamut, but in this case it could simply clip them, or let the 3DLUT clip them, which would make them look oversaturated.

I guess it maps them back in gamut anyway, but maybe using a source DCI-P3 3DLUT is safer.
Alexkral is offline   Reply With Quote